Noomi Rapace Is Ridley Scott's Favorite For Alien Prequel Lead!

The Girl With The Dragon Tattoo actress Noomi Rapace is now said to be first in line for the lead role in Ridley Scott's Prequel to Alien...

About a month back Deadline reported that Noomi Rapace was a possible choice for Ridley Scott's prequel to iconic Sci-Fi movie series, Alien. Now Deadline is claiming that not only is she being considered, she is top choice for the role by the director and producers. After Nabbing the female lead in the sequel to Sherlock Holmes could Noomi possibly get another lead role?

Deadline's list for the actresses also in connection to the role include Carey Mulligan, Abbie Cornish, Natalie Portman and Olivia Wilde. Natalie Portman was also rumored to be clinching the role a few weeks back. Apparently each person on the list has gone to a meeting with the crew this week. Deadline is also saying Rapace's English may be a negative factor in whether or not she gets the role.
